Historical Significance and Modern Adaptation

The origins of coin tossing can be traced back to ancient Rome, where it was used to resolve disputes. Known as “Navia aut Caput,” the practice was steeped in ritual significance. Over centuries, this straightforward decision-making tool found its way into various cultures, becoming a game of chance. With the advent of online casinos, coin toss games have transitioned seamlessly into the digital arena, retaining their inherent simplicity while benefiting from modern gaming technology.

Provably Fair Mechanics Explained

One of the significant advancements in online coin toss games is the implementation of provably fair mechanics. This technological feature allows players to verify the fairness of each game round. Using cryptographic techniques, players can access server seeds and verify the randomness of results, ensuring that no manipulation occurs. This transparency fosters trust between players and operators, making the gaming experience more reassuring and equitable.

Betting Strategies for Coin Toss

Classic Strategies: Martingale and Fibonacci

When engaging in coin toss games, employing effective betting strategies can significantly influence outcomes. The Martingale strategy is a well-known system where players double their bet after a loss, aiming to recoup losses with a subsequent win. While this method can work temporarily, it's important to approach it cautiously—the risk of significant losses exists if a losing streak occurs. Alternatively, the Fibonacci strategy follows a sequence that allows for more gradual increases in bets, which can help manage losses more effectively.

Adapting to Risk Management with Paroli

The Paroli betting system serves as a counterpoint to the Martingale strategy. Rather than increasing bets after losses, Paroli encourages players to double their bets after wins, aiming to capitalize on winning streaks. This method aids in preserving bankroll while potentially increasing profits. Coin Toss vs. Xoc Dia: Understanding the Differences

Xoc Dia, a traditional Vietnamese game involving coins, offers more complex rules and a variety of betting options compared to single coin toss games. This complexity can be overwhelming for players unfamiliar with the game. Coin toss games, in contrast, emphasize simplicity and quick gameplay, appealing to a broader audience. The minimalist structure encourages players to engage without the steep learning curve typically associated with more intricate games.
